Very Happy Edmonson County Lions Club Fair is hosting a Cornhole tournament on Saturday September 6th starting at 10:00 am. Two person teams allowed and entry fee is $40.00 per team. We have 10 same sets of boards. This will be a Double elimination tournament. Laughing Payout will be 40% of total entry fee for 1st place and 15% of total entry fee for 2nd place. Wink The Fairgrounds are located 2 miles south of Brownsville, KY on Hwy 259. For more information please contact Mike Blanton at (270) 791-8363. Please come out and enjoy our tournament and our Fair. Razz
